La La Anthony
June 25, 1981 (age 44)
Brooklyn, New York, USA
Bio
- Entered the entertainment industry at the age of 16 while working at an Atlanta radio station, with a pre-fame Chris "Ludacris" Bridges.
- Founded the production company Krossover Productions, which produced the critically-acclaimed documentary Tyson in 2008.
- Performed in the off-Broadway production of Love, Loss and What I Wore in 2011.
- In 2012, was named in Maxim magazine's Hot 100 list.
- Is the designer of her own fashion line, 5th & Mercer.
- Published her first book in 2014, The Love Playbook: Rules for Love, Sex, and Happiness, which became a number 1 New York Times Bestseller.
